Using Your Inspiron Laptop

1

USB 2.0 connector — Connects to USB devices, such as a mouse, keyboard, printer,

external drive, or MP3 player.

2

HDMI connector — Connects to a TV for both 5.1 audio and video signals.

NOTE: When used with a monitor, only the video signal is read.

3

eSATA/USB combo connector with USB PowerShare — Connects to eSATA

compatible storage devices (such as external hard drives or optical drives) or USB devices
(such as a mouse, keyboard, printer, external drive, or MP3 player). The USB PowerShare
feature allows you to charge USB devices when the computer is powered on/off or in
sleep state.
NOTE: Certain USB devices may not charge when the computer is powered off or in
sleep state. In such cases, turn on the computer to charge the device.
NOTE:

If you turn off your computer while charging a USB device, the device stops

charging. To continue charging, disconnect the USB device and connect it again.
NOTE: The USB PowerShare feature is automatically shut off when only 10% of the total
battery life remains.
